Steelers draft LB Sean Spence

PITTSBURGH (AP) - The Pittsburgh Steelers have taken Miami (Fla.) linebacker Sean Spence in the third round of the NFL Draft.

The Steelers chose Spence with the 86th overall pick.

Spence will give Pittsburgh some depth at inside linebacker following the release of veteran James Farrior. Spence will compete with Stevenson Sylvester for a backup spot behind Lawrence Timmons and Larry Foote.

The 5-foot-11, 231-pound Spence started 40 games during his career with the Hurricanes and ranks 11th in school history with 318 tackles, including a team-high 106 tackles as a senior last fall.

Linebackers coach Keith Butler says he sees Spence eventually working behind Timmons and is impressed with Spence's speed, which should be a plus on special teams.
